A Native American group that is protesting Thanksgiving, Hallucinogenic Drugs, and Provincetown performer Kandi Kane.

  • 11:32 - Hal Fuller presents The GenderTalk Twisted, Nasty News.
  • 21:54 - Mahtohwin, from the United American Indians of New England, protests Thanksgiving at Plymouth Rock.
  • 44:08 - Announcements.
  • 51:03 - Terence McKenna is an expert on hallucinogenic drugs.
  • 80:52 - Kandi Kane is a TG performer, currently in Provincetown, MA, and describes the entertainment scene there.
  • 92:07 - End.
